Tell us about the INFINITE Leadership Program?
The INFINITE Leadership Program is about unlocking opportunities and possibilities. It’s a journey that combines personal and professional growth, with each letter of the word INFINITE being its own pillar. It facilitates individuals and teams to reflect, review and recalibrate on their continuous improvement journey to create excellence for everyone.
The pillars, Identity, Nurturing (emotional intelligence and agility) Fearlessness,
Innovation, Nobility, Influence, Transformation and Ecosystem are designed to help and empower leaders while also creating a ripple effect of positive change for those they lead. Leadership is not static; it requires adaptability, self-awareness, and a commitment to continuous improvement.
This innovative program, individuals and teams engage in a process that challenges their current thinking, equips them with practical tools, and inspires them to embrace innovation, influence, and impact. It’s not about quick fixes—it’s about building a foundation for lasting excellence.
Can you share a success story?
I received a concerned call from a very experienced leader, who despite her depth of leadership experience was finding that her executive leadership team was not performing well, were disjointed and this was having a ripple effect throughout the organization. Through a series of 1:1, group coaching and workshops over the course of 6 months we were able to identify some key barriers to moving the team forward, and through utilizing the INFINITE model, we were able to create a safe space for brave and courageous conversations. It had such a positive impact that I was asked to implement the approach with a different sector within the same organization. Four years later, some of the staff have moved on to different organizations and still reach out and share how they are utilizing the skills they developed through this work in their new positions that are all promotional positions, that they also received as a result of their personal and professional growth and development.
